WELLINGTON, New Zealand (Reuters) — Thousands of ecstatic fans cheered “The Lord of the Rings” at the world premiere of the final installment of the award-winning movie trilogy. Like a victorious general at the front of his army, home-grown director Peter Jackson led stars from “The Return of the King” for five km (3 miles) through central Wellington on Monday, flanked by characters clad in armor and on black horses. The runaway success of The Lord of the Rings movie trilogy may be followed by a screen version of JRR Tolkien’s original work, The Hobbit, although it would be a few years away. Mark Ordesky, the Rings executive producer, made clear his New Line Cinema company had not finished with the world of Middle Earth following the completion of The Return of the King, the final movie in The Lord of the Rings trilogy.
